2. What is Instagram Story?

Instagram stories are short-lived photos or videos that are posted on the platform for 24 hours before they disappear from view. They can be accessed by swiping up from the main page or tapping on someone’s profile picture in the top left corner of the app, and they appear at the top of everyone’s feed in chronological order. Stories allow users to create fun and creative content that stands out from their regular posts, making them a great way to engage with followers and stand out from other accounts in their niche.

3. How to share an Instagram Post to your Story?

Sharing posts from your feed to your story is easy! All you have to do is open up the post that you want to share and then tap on the “share” button located at the bottom right corner of the post (it looks like a paper airplane). You will then be presented with three options: Direct Message (DM), Add To Your Story, or Copy Link (to share outside of Instagram). Choose “Add To Your Story” and then customize it however you like! You can add text, stickers, GIFs, etc., just like any other story post before sharing it with all of your followers!

4. Benefits of Sharing an Instagram Post to Your Story

Sharing posts from your feed into stories has several benefits: It allows you to repurpose existing content into something new; it helps increase engagement by exposing old content to new audiences; it also creates a sense of consistency between stories and regular posts; finally, it helps build relationships with followers by giving them more opportunities to interact with you through comments & likes!
